Statistical Analysis of VSG Rodent Study

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
GraphPad Prism statistical software 7.0c (La Jolla, CA) was used to analyze data. The results are expressed as means ± SE, and one-way and two-way independent repeated-measures analysis of variance (ANOVA) were applied where appropriate. A Tukey’s multiple comparison test was performed to further analyze significant interactions. A P value <0.05 was considered to be statistically significant. Linear regression was used to correlate cumulative food intake and percentage weight change for the entire cohort (n=34). Data for microbiome and liver and plasma lipid analyses were generated for 6 randomly-selected rodents per group (Sham n=6; VSG1 n=6; VSG2 n=6). All other analyses and corresponding graphs included the entire cohort (Sham n=10; VSG1 n=12; VSG2 n=12).

Statistical Analysis of Research Data

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
GraphPad Prism statistical software 7.0c (La Jolla, CA) was used to analyze data. The results are expressed as means ± standard error (SE). Analyses were performed using Chisquared, McNemar’s test, t-test, and linear regressions as appropriate. A P value <0.05 was considered to be statistically significant.
